DOE Advances High-Voltage Direct Current
1 day ago· The U.S. Department of Energy''s Wind Energy Technologies Office and the Office of Electricity announced the selection of four high-voltage direct current (HVDC) transmission projects as part of the Innovative Designs for high-performance low-cost HVDC Converters (IDEAL HVDC) program. Recent Advances of Wind-Solar Hybrid Renewable Energy
A hybrid renewable energy source (HRES) consists of two or more renewable energy sources, suchas wind turbines and photovoltaic systems, utilized together to provide increased system efficiency and improved stability in energy supply to a certain degree. Press Release | arpa-e.energy.gov
WASHINGTON, D.C. — The U.S. Department of Energy (DOE) today announced $41 million for 14 projects to develop technologies, Renewables-to-Liquids (RtL), for harnessing renewable energy sources like wind and solar to produce liquids for sustainable fuels or chemicals that can be transported and stored as easily as carbon-intensive liquids like gasoline or oil.
